Key Insights
- The Probability Grid by LuxAlgo is a tool designed to visually predict market reversals by displaying probabilities on a 10x10 grid or dashboard.
- The grid shows probabilities of reversals occurring beyond or within specific price zones, helping traders identify potential turning points.
- Customization options include swing length, maximum reversals, data normalization, and probability mode, offering flexibility in analysis.
- The tool can be used in 'Probability Beyond Each Cell' mode, indicating the chance of reversal before price exceeds a cell, or 'Probability Within Each Cell' mode, showing reversal likelihood within a cell.
- Combining the Probability Grid with RSI divergence offers a robust setup for identifying potential bullish or bearish reversals.
- Bullish setups involve identifying low-percentage cells on the grid and confirming with RSI divergence before entering long positions.
- Bearish setups require spotting bearish divergence on RSI and a low-percentage cell on the grid before entering short positions.
- The Probability Grid is a flexible tool that requires combining with other analyses and is not a standalone financial advice tool.

Questions & Answers
Q: What is the Probability Grid indicator?
The Probability Grid indicator by LuxAlgo is a tool that visually represents the probability of market reversals. It uses a grid or dashboard to display probabilities of reversals occurring beyond or within specific price zones. This helps traders identify potential turning points and make informed trading decisions.
Q: How does the Probability Grid work?
The Probability Grid works by displaying a 10x10 grid or dashboard on a price chart, filled with numbers representing probabilities of market reversals. It offers two modes: 'Probability Beyond Each Cell' and 'Probability Within Each Cell,' helping traders interpret reversal chances and identify potential turning points.
Q: What customization options does the Probability Grid offer?
The Probability Grid offers several customization options, including swing length, maximum reversals, data normalization, and probability mode. Traders can adjust these settings to fit their trading style, allowing for a flexible and personalized approach to analyzing potential market turning points.
Q: How can the Probability Grid be used with RSI divergence?
The Probability Grid can be combined with RSI divergence for a more robust trading setup. By identifying bullish or bearish divergence on the RSI and confirming with low-percentage cells on the grid, traders can enhance their strategy and increase the confidence in their trades, identifying potential reversals more effectively.
Q: What is the 'Probability Beyond Each Cell' mode?
'Probability Beyond Each Cell' mode indicates the chance of a market reversal occurring before the price moves beyond a particular cell on the grid. For instance, if a cell shows a 5% probability, it suggests a 95% chance of reversal before the price exceeds that cell, helping traders gauge potential overextension.
Q: What is the 'Probability Within Each Cell' mode?
'Probability Within Each Cell' mode indicates the likelihood of a market reversal occurring within a specific cell on the grid. This mode flips the interpretation, showing the probability of reversal happening precisely within that cell, aiding traders in pinpointing potential reversal zones more accurately.
